Description A Chinese Export Porcelain Covered Soup Tureen and Stand
Early 19th century
The tureen and cover painted with oval reserves with groups of figures, the platter similarly decorated, with apricot bands and borders decorated in brown and gilding.
Length of platter 14 3/8 inches.
